PHEW. Day One is over.

 

Attendance was great for a Montreal show. There must have been over 2,000 people. MANY women and kids. Always a good sign. It only died down around 3:30/4PM.

 

My sales were solid considering all of the competition and the fact I only had one table. My notable sales:

 

1) PLENTY of low grade SA/BA DC and MARVEL (mostly BAT titles, X-MEN, and ASM issues).

2) BATMAN #232,

3) GL #76 (I hope you're pleased DIKRAN!),

4) ASM #40,

5) ASM #122,

6) ALI vs. SUPERMAN, and

7) NEW MUTANTS #98

FYI gang. My neighbor at the show sold a SHOWCASE #22 in about 2.5ish to another dealer for $425.00 CDN. Pretty high for resale, but the book is hot and I know everyone is tracking the sales of this book.

There was a surprisingly large number of mid-grade, higher value comics like FF and ASM 3-10. There were some nice GA books around, but the only Timely I saw was at Harley's booth. He came all the way to Montreal with only one small box which he put on the wall (to his left in the pic). They were all nice books, but out of my price range. I was looking for early Tecs in the 6.0-7.0 range. Harley had three, but all VF/NM. The big thing this year was the number of people and the costumes which we rarely have.
